If dragging your finger across the letters does nothing, or the keyboard keeps guessing the wrong word while you glide between keys, the built-in gesture typing might be switched off or set to the wrong mode. Samsung labels this feature keyboard swipe control, while most other Android keyboards call the same trick glide typing or swipe typing. Getting the setting right decides whether the keyboard reacts to continuous finger movement at all.

Swipe typing lets you drag one finger from letter to letter instead of tapping each key separately. Samsung builds this into its own keyboard under the name keyboard swipe controls, even though the underlying gesture is the same one other Android phones call glide typing.

When the setting is turned off, dragging across the keys produces nothing or triggers stray letters, because the keyboard only registers individual taps. When it is switched on but set to the wrong mode, words can come out garbled if your finger moves too fast between distant letters or if autocorrect misreads the gesture.

The option sits inside the Samsung Keyboard settings, separate from the general system input settings. To reach it:

SettingsGeneral managementSamsung Keyboard settingsSwipe, touch, and feedbackKeyboard swipe controls ➔ choose No swipe gestures or Swipe to type

Picking No swipe gestures disables the feature completely and forces tap-only typing, which helps if the keyboard keeps misreading gestures as accidental key presses. Picking Swipe to type turns gesture typing back on.

If words still come out wrong after switching to Swipe to type, the issue is usually autocorrect guessing the wrong word rather than the gesture setting itself.
